Raymond and Isaura
Raymond sat outside the tent all night. Isaura had been sleeping peacefully. When the morning rays broke over the horizon, he could hear her stirring from within. He had stayed up all night, the pain in his arm and chest hurting too much to sleep. He had sufficiently stopped the bleeding, but the loss of blood was starting to make him very weak. Inside the tent, Isaura spoke.
"Raymond? Is everything okay? How are you?"
"Oh, I...I'm fine, but will need to get this arm looked at soon. How are you?"
Isaura stepped out of the tent, rubbing her neck where the mad man-beast had grabbed her.
"I am fine, I guess. My neck is a little tender from last night. But I will be okay. Are you sure that arm of your's is going to be okay?"
"Well, it has stopped bleeding, thugh it hurts, of course. I say that we get onto the road as soon as we are ready to go. I would really like to see a doctor, or something. "
And so, they had a quick breakfast of berries that grew along the path and some dried bread that had been with them in travelling. They sat out on the road, and began to walk.
They kept rather quiet, both pondering the dangers that had been presented them the night before, and what else they might meet along the way. Raymond had asked a little about Isaura's magic and how she had learned it, but Isaura was not up to telling a long story. She promised to speak on it again, when they were safe and well.
By the time that the sun was low in the sky, they happened upon a single log home in the woods. Cautiously, they approached this home and knocked on the door. An old, happy looking man greeted them.
The travellors quickly explained that they had been wandering in the wilderness for some time, and had been attacked by wild beasts, though they mentioned nothing aboutn it being a panter-were. In fact, they were both trying to forget that, as well. The old man, welcomed them into his home and spoke, thus:
"Ere now! Come inside and lets look at that those cuts! I have some medical supplies and a couple healing potions available. Please, come inside!"
"Sir, I am afraid we are without money, but if we may work off our debt to repay you for the kindness, I am a skilled farmer, and offer my service to you, while this wound heals".
"And I can offer my cooking and cleaning service to you, as well."
So, the old man became busy, looking for his cures and bandages. Within an hour, he had redressed the wounds and had poured a bottle of healing potion down Rayond's throat. Isaura began immediately, in cleaning up his house and even asking if there was any sowing to be done. Raymond was already feeling well enough to offer weeding the garden before sunset. But the old man smiled and said,
"Please, take a seat and rest a while. I have been widowed now for 3 years and would like some company. Tell me, what news have you of the world?"
Raymond and Isaura took turns, describing where they were from and how they had ended up together and here at the present time. The old man was grateful to have guests, and at nighttime, he showed them to their rooms with a promise of the biggest breakfast they had ever seen awaiting them in the morning. They each took to their separate room and found sleep instantly.
